McGuigan won International Winemaker of the Year in 2009, 2011 & 2012, along with Australian Producer of the Year in 2009, 2011, 2012 & 2013.
The fruit for this full-bodied Shiraz so typical of the great Barossa Valley comes from low-yielding vineyards in the southern Lyndoch area and the Barossa Hills. The Lyndoch area grows fruit with exceptional depth and power, whereas the fruit from the Barossa Hills express intense pepper spice and structure yet a natural elegance. The combination of these parcels is magical, producing a well balanced wine of great power and finesse.
You can look forward to a classic, fruit-driven, fragrant Barossa Shiraz displaying ripe mulberry and plum characteristics, and thanks to good oak-ageing, a touch of subtle vanilla and spice.
